Choosing the Right Affordable Bristle DartboardThe foundation of any good dart setup is a high-quality, yet affordable, bristle dartboard. While sisal fiber boards are the standard for professional play, many entry-level options offer incredible durability without a high price tag. Look for boards designed for home use that feature staple-free bullseyes and thin, round wire, which minimize bounce-outs. Brands like Winmau, Viper, and Unicorn offer budget-friendly “home” versions of their competition boards, ensuring you get that satisfying “thwack” without spending a fortune. These boards are built to self-heal, meaning they will last through the long autumn and winter months, providing excellent value for your money.

Budget-Friendly Darts That PerformOnce you have the board, you need darts. The temptation might be to buy the cheapest set available, but for a slightly higher, yet still very affordable price, you can invest in brass or nickel-silver darts that offer better grip and balance. Many beginner sets come in varied weights, typically between 18 and 22 grams for steel-tip, which are ideal for beginners. To make it more fun for autumn, look for sets that offer colored flights—deep reds, oranges, or black—to match the seasonal theme. Purchasing a “starter kit” that includes extra flights and shafts is a smart, budget-conscious move, as it ensures you’re prepared for any maintenance issues without needing to buy new darts immediately.

Setting Up Your Autumn Darts AreaYou don’t need a dedicated games room to enjoy darts. Creating a cozy, intimate space is all about clever placement and simple, low-cost accessories. A standard dartboard only requires a clear wall, a sturdy backing (like a simple dart cabinet or a DIY corkboard surround to protect your walls), and about 8 feet of floor space. To bring that autumn feeling into the room, focus on lighting. Simple, inexpensive LED spotlights aimed at the board can eliminate shadows and make the game feel more dramatic. You can also hang a decorative, rustic dartboard surround or craft a wooden cabinet that fits the cozy, comfortable aesthetic of the season.

Enhancing the Fun with Simple AccessoriesTo make your autumn dart setup truly inviting, you can add small, affordable touches that enhance the experience. A simple, low-cost chalkboard for scoring, or even a dry-erase board, makes it easy for friends to track their wins. If you are handy, a DIY scoreboard using chalkboard paint on a piece of wood can add a personal, rustic touch. Furthermore, investing in a cheap dartboard mat is not only great for protecting your floors from stray darts, but it also clearly marks the throw line, removing any debate about proper distance. These small additions improve the overall atmosphere of the room without adding significant cost to your setup.
